Description

The primary purpose of this position is to support regulatory reporting of equity and option transactions for Wealth Management, focusing on managing the firm's Consolidated Audit Trail (CAT) reporting needs, structure, and governance. The role involves understanding trade flows, order events, and customer account reporting, as well as ensuring the accuracy and compliance of trade reporting.

Ce que nous recherchons

Support regulatory reporting of equity and option transactions for Wealth Management.,Manage the firm's Consolidated Audit Trail (CAT) reporting needs, structure, and governance.,Understand trade flows, order events, and customer account reporting.,Be responsible for tactical vetting and solutions of trade reporting, ensuring accuracy and compliance.,Verify accuracy of CAT requirements and mapping, and implement process modifications.,Confirm documentation, policy & procedures are in place for all business processes relating to CAT.,Provide ongoing risk management and drive future CAT deliverables.,Manage open project deficiencies and deliverables.,Work with business lines to assess new trade flows for accurate reporting.,Maintain a holistic focus on documentation and process logic review.,Review, design, and implement new processes/process changes and procedures to increase efficiency, reduce risk, or enrich service.,Perform ongoing production support and maintenance updates for established end-user efficiency solutions.,Assign responsibility and provide ongoing oversight to business and technical areas as necessary.,Assist in pulling data for regulatory inquiries.,Participate in business requirement development, UAT testing, end-user training, and implementation support for enhancements and new firm initiatives.,Develop and provide ongoing training support for end-user resources.,Provide feedback to department leadership team when appropriate.
